How to consume english laddu without glucose spikes

Portion Control

Start by reducing the portion size of the laddu you consume. Smaller servings can lead to smaller glucose spikes.

Fiber-Rich Foods

Pair the laddu with foods high in fiber, such as vegetables or legumes, as they can slow down glucose absorption.

Protein Addition

Include a source of protein, such as a handful of nuts or a boiled egg, with your snack to help stabilize blood sugar levels.

Healthy Fats

Add healthy fats like avocado or a small serving of seeds to your meal to help moderate glucose absorption.

Hydration

Drink plenty of water throughout the day to help your body manage blood sugar levels more effectively.

Physical Activity

Engage in light physical activity, such as a brisk walk, after consuming the laddu to aid in glucose uptake by the muscles.

Timing

Avoid consuming the laddu on an empty stomach. Have it as part of a balanced meal to minimize the impact on your blood sugar.

Herbal Teas

Enjoy a cup of herbal tea, like chamomile or cinnamon tea, which may aid in better glucose control.

Alternative Snacks

Consider substituting the laddu with snacks like hummus and vegetable sticks or a small fruit salad made with berries.

Mindful Eating

Practice mindful eating by savoring each bite slowly, which can improve digestion and the body’s response to glucose.
